Celtic 'join' Kyle Joseph transfer chase as Scottish champions eye another cross-border signing in Wigan starlet

Celtic have reportedly joined the chase for Wigan's Kyle Joseph.

The 19-year-old striker is enjoying a breakout season at the troubled League One club, netting a hat-trick against Burton Albion two weeks ago.

The Latics are still in administration after a points deduction saw them tumble to the third tier from the Championship last term and a proposed takeover bid collapsed last week.

That's left the futures of some of Wigan's best players uncertain - including Joseph, who would be available for Scottish clubs on a pre-contract deal this summer.

And now it appears Celtic have arrived on the scene, with the Daily Mirror reporting their interest.

Rangers were linked with a move for the teenager over the weekend. But Record Sport understands Steven Gerrard's side are not interested.

It has been reported Tottenham Hotspur and Sheffield United are keen, though, as Joseph catches the eye of some English Premier League big-hitters.

Joseph is a Scotland Under-19s international and Wigan - who sit second bottom and are in danger of a second relegation in a row - have offered him a new deal meaning they'll be entitled to some cross-border compensation if a move materialises.
